inflow-inventory is a comprehensive inventory management software designed to help businesses efficiently track and manage their stock levels, orders, and sales. It offers features such as barcode scanning, reporting, and multi-location support to streamline inventory processes.
Learn moreMicrosoft OneDrive is a file hosting service operated by Microsoft. First released in August 2007, it allows registered users to store, share and sync their files. OneDrive also works as the storage backend of the web version of Microsoft 365 / Office.

Yes. viaSocket uses instant triggers where available, so data moves between inflow-inventory and OneDrive as soon as the event happens. Scheduled polling triggers run at a maximum interval of 15 minutes.
